The Villainess's Reckoning

In the billionaire romance The Villainess's Reckoning, Quinn rules her marriage with Nathan through paranoid obsession and extreme demands. However, her reality shatters when supernatural comments appear before her eyes, revealing that Nathan has been unfaithful and contracted a life-threatening illness. Realizing she is cast as a villainess destined for a tragic end, Quinn must pivot. She abruptly rejects his advances to protect herself, desperate to alter her fate before the story's true heroine arrives to replace her.

Chapter 1

Nathan Carter was famous in high society for being completely devoted to his wife.

All because I had an almost obsessive need to control him.

Not only did he have to video call me every five minutes to check in, but every morning when I woke up, I expected a five-thousand-word love letter waiting for me.

The first time he was a minute late checking in, my paranoia spiraled out of control, and I bombarded him with ninety-nine voice messages, threatening to kill myself.

He transferred me one million dollars, dropped to his knees, and swore it would never happen again before I reluctantly forgave him.

His voice softened as he leaned closer, trying to kiss me.

Suddenly, a flood of comments exploded across my vision.

[Exactly! Once Quinn catches HIV, he should dump her. A villainess like her deserves to get sick, lose the baby, and die a miserable death!]

[Who could put up with a crazy woman like her? If she hadn't pushed the male lead so hard, he never would've slept around and contracted HIV!]

[When is the female lead finally going to show up? I can't wait for her and the male lead to heal each other and get their happily ever after!]

I looked at Nathan, who had already taken off his shirt, his breathing heavy.

I hurriedly grabbed a towel from the side and wrapped it around myself.

"Honey, I'm suddenly not feeling very well. Don't you have a meeting to get to? You should go. I don't want to keep you from work."

Nathan Carter froze in stunned disbelief for a moment.

The next second, he quickly forced a flattering smile and took both of my hands in his.

"Honey, did I say something wrong just now and upset you?

"If you're unhappy, then hit or yell at me. Just don't bottle it up, okay?"

His voice was gentle, his posture humble.

He sounded exactly as he always did when he was trying to calm me down.

But now, as I stared at the endless stream of floating comments scrolling before my eyes, a chill spread through my entire body.

[Wait, this isn't right. If this crazy woman pushes the male lead away, how is she supposed to get HIV?]

[I'm still waiting to see the villainess get sick, lose her baby, and die a miserable death. The plot isn't going off the rails, is it?]

[Relax. The male lead hasn't even met the love of his life yet! Once he does, he'd give up everything, even his life, to save her. Does a psycho like this woman really deserve him?]

"Honey?"

I pulled my hands away.

Instead of throwing one of my usual hysterical fits, I spoke softly.

"I'm tired. I want to take a shower."

Nathan looked up at me.

In that instant, his eyes widened with even greater surprise.

I knew exactly what he was thinking.

Since the age of fifteen, when had Quinn Hart ever been this reasonable?

But he didn't ask any questions. He simply continued in a gentle, soothing tone.

"Then get some rest. If you get sleepy, go ahead and sleep. I'll bring you a late-night snack when I get back."

Soon, the sound of running water echoed through the bathroom.

The water cascaded over my body, yet it couldn't wash away the turmoil surging inside me.

The memory of those floating comments made me lower the water temperature even further.

Why was it that he could sleep around, contract HIV, and yet I was the one destined to die?

Why was it that after infecting the so-called female lead, he could still bankrupt himself developing treatments for her and then live happily ever after by her side?

I took a deep breath and forced myself to calm down.

I had always been someone who lacked a sense of security.

As the heiress of one of the most influential families in the city, I had seen far too many men lose themselves to power and temptation.

That was why I treated Nathan as my personal possession, using the most extreme methods possible to tame him and keep him under my control.

He proposed to me seven times, and I turned him down seven times.

It wasn't until the eighth proposal that he stood before both of our families and produced a notarized agreement.

"If I ever betray you one day, I'll walk away with nothing. I’ll give every share and property to you."

I was moved by his sincerity and finally said yes.

The more I thought about it, the more ridiculous I felt.

In his eyes, I was exhausting, irrational, and impossibly controlling.

Someone who never gave him room to breathe.

So, he went out looking for excitement elsewhere, and ended up contracting HIV.

That agreement was still locked inside my safe.

I wasn't just going to divorce him; I was going to make him lose everything.

By the time I finished showering and stepped out, Nathan had already changed into a perfectly tailored suit.

"Honey, the office keeps calling. I'll come straight back and spend time with you as soon as the meeting's over."

The floating comments appeared again.

[Here it comes! In the original plot, this is the banquet where the male lead meets the female lead, Vivian Reed!]

[The classic damsel-in-distress scene! Vivian gets pressured into drinking by a group of rich girls, and the male lead steps in to protect her. So cool!]

[That idiot Quinn still has no idea her husband is about to meet the love of his life tonight.]

My heart pounded as I read the comments.

The moment Nathan left, I headed out and flagged down a taxi.

"Bluewater Bay Hotel."

The floating comments instantly exploded.

[How does she know where the male lead is going?!]

[No way! Can the villainess actually see our comments?!]

[Impossible. She's a character in a book. There's no way she can see them.]

I watched the lines of text drift across my vision one after another and curled my lips into a faint smile.

So, what if I could see them?

My fate had always been mine to decide.

The taxi pulled up in front of the hotel.

I stepped out in my heels, entered the lobby, and followed the floating comments' real-time updates all the way to the elevator.

[Look, look! Vivian just got shoved onto the floor! Wine's all over her dress. Poor thing!]

[Nathan's already at the door. He's about to walk in!]

The elevator doors opened.

I immediately spotted the girl in the white dress.

Several heavily made-up socialites had her surrounded.

Red wine dripped from her hair, making her look both pitiful and heartbreakingly vulnerable.

Nathan, standing off to one side, had just started to step forward.

I picked up a glass of champagne from the bar and walked straight toward Vivian.
